Output 51cbdc266c2ecb7e5f8306410d302f27d7a753bcb828e34665c167d6224abbe6:41

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7afc41bddb61d08afb22352a309fca659323530 OP_EQUAL
address
MQeQSyUCwun7qqKERuB1oi1UDy7vb7eCXB
transaction
51cbdc266c2ecb7e5f8306410d302f27d7a753bcb828e34665c167d6224abbe6
spent
true